So I went trolling around on pintrest to see what was new. There wasn't much except an article about how we are killing crochet. With all the free stuff online it's getting harder and harder to make a living in the craft world. Instead of paying for a class you can go on YouTube and learn the techniques for free. As for patterns, you can find almost anything online for free. And don't get me started on all the people that undervalue their work.
I didn't agree with everything the article said, I am more of the opinion that the craft business community needs to adapt to the availability that the Internet provides. Classes can focus on a project or on design. Books and patterns need to be multifunctional to appeal to those of us willing to spend money on such things.
It may take a new generation of crafters to see these changes made. But we crafters are a hardy lot. We will survive. We will adapt and change and grow.
